### CI note: Harwick Mills SFTP drop failing intermittently

The nightly partner ingest from Harwick Mills lands files in the inbound drop before 02:00, but their server occasionally renames files mid-transfer, so our watcher picks up partial uploads. We added a 90-second quiesce check in pipeline step `verify-drop`; do not remove it. If the job still fails, confirm the file checksum manifest arrived before retrying. When escalating to the Harwick liaison, always include the trace token printed below.

build token for bajog-yaduf: htk9_39788324c

## Configuration: export retries

Fellgrove retries failed exports automatically. `EXPORT_RETRY_MAX` (default 5) caps attempts, and `EXPORT_RETRY_BACKOFF_MS` sets the initial delay, doubling per attempt. Permanently failed exports move to the review queue. Retried uploads must re-authenticate to the export gateway, so add the following line to your env file.

vault entry, kafog-yahop: COURIER_KEY8=0faa53ae

Welcome to the Quillhaven support rotation! You'll occasionally see the read-replica lag alarm fire for our Pondermill database cluster. Usually it clears itself in a few minutes, but if lag stays above 30 seconds, check the replica dashboard and restart the sync worker. To do that locally, your .env needs the replication token set on the next line.

vault entry, yahif-yajep: COURIER_KEY29=b802bdf8034096b65a51c6ba5abe2